Overview of DDMPR’s Market Context
DDMP REIT Inc. (DDMPR) closed at ₱1.06 on January 21, 2025, with a -2.75% decline from the previous session. The day’s high was ₱1.08, and the low was ₱1.05, aligning closely with key moving averages. Volume stood at 3.022 million, indicating moderate trading interest.
A critical factor in today’s market action is the ex-dividend date of DDMPR. Historically, REITs tend to decline after the ex-date as investors adjust for the dividend payout. Let’s analyze this chart using our Hybrid 10-Step Trading Strategy to assess its potential movement.
DDMPR’s January 21, 2025, stock chart showing key technical levels post-ex-dividend.
Step 1: Identifying Market State & Trend Context
- 200-day MA (₱1.09): The price is still below the long-term moving average, indicating an overall downtrend.
- 20-day MA (₱1.05): The stock has been consolidating around this short-term support level.
- Trend Context: After a prolonged sideways phase, the stock has been attempting a short-term recovery but faces resistance near the 200-day MA.
📌 Conclusion: DDMPR is in an early trend reversal attempt but still struggling to break key resistances.
Step 2: Assessing Price Position Relative to Key Levels
- The closing price (₱1.06) is above the 20-day MA (₱1.05) but below the 200-day MA (₱1.09).
- A successful break and close above ₱1.09 could confirm a potential reversal.
📌 Conclusion: Caution is needed, as failure to hold above ₱1.05 could signal a pullback.
Step 3: Power Bars & Retracement Strength
- The recent bullish push showed higher-than-average volume, but today’s red candle signals profit-taking.
- The current retracement is moderate, suggesting this could be a temporary pullback.
📌 Conclusion: Watch for a green power bar in the next few sessions for confirmation.
Step 4: Entry Confirmation Using Technical Alignment
- The ideal entry would be near the ₱1.05 support zone with a confirmation signal (e.g., bounce with strong volume).
- Breakout Entry: A close above ₱1.09 could confirm bullish momentum.
📌 Conclusion: No clear entry signal yet, but potential setups exist if it holds above ₱1.05.
Step 5: Tactical Stop-Loss Adjustments
- A logical stop-loss would be below ₱1.03 (recent swing low).
- If it breaks below ₱1.05 decisively, a deeper correction may follow.
📌 Conclusion: Risk management is crucial—tight stops recommended below ₱1.03.
Step 6: Color Change as Secondary Confirmation
- The price needs a green candle tomorrow to confirm strength.
- If the next session turns red, it may indicate further weakness.
📌 Conclusion: A color change to green at this level would be a bullish signal.
Step 7: Profit-Taking Strategy
- If entered at ₱1.05, potential profit-taking zones:
- Partial Exit at ₱1.10 (above 200-day MA resistance and adjusted for transaction cost)
- Full Exit at ₱1.15 (previous resistance)
📌 Conclusion: Short-term traders may consider scaling out if price struggles at ₱1.10.
Step 8: Re-Entry at Secondary Pullbacks
- Best re-entry: If price pulls back near ₱1.03-₱1.05 and holds.
- Aggressive traders could attempt a momentum breakout trade if it surges past ₱1.09.
📌 Conclusion: Monitor for re-entry opportunities around ₱1.05.
Step 9: Tactical Position Management
- Shallow retracement (₱1.05-₱1.06) → Can consider larger positions.
- Deeper retracement (₱1.03) → Smaller position with tight stop.
📌 Conclusion: Size positions accordingly based on retracement depth.
Step 10: Counter-Trend Trading Considerations
- If the price fails to hold ₱1.05, a counter-trend short may be possible down to ₱1.00.
- However, trading against a REIT’s support levels can be risky.
📌 Conclusion: Avoid counter-trend shorts unless a major breakdown occurs.
